Mayawati Demands Separate OBC Census, Says 'BSP Will Support Govt In Parliament'

BSP supremo Mayawati on Friday said that her party will support the central government if it takes a positive decision on conducting a separate census for the OBC community.

Lucknow: BSP supremo Mayawati has demanded a separate OBC census amid demand for a caste-based census in the country. Former CM Mayawati has also proposed to support the Central government on the issue. Mayawati said on Friday that BSP will definitely support the Central government not only in the Parliament but also outside if it takes a positive step regarding the demand for a separate census of OBC community in the country.

Mayawati tweeted, "BSP has been demanding a separate census of OBC community in the country from the very beginning. If the Central government takes positive steps in this matter, then BSP will definitely support the government inside and outside the Parliament. 

Recently,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ar demanded a caste census to be conducted in the country. CM Nitish has also written a letter to PM Narendra Modi on the same.

The last caste census was held in 1931 before the country attained independence. Based on this figure, it is reported that the OBC population in the country is 52 percent. The Mandal Commission had a lot of difficulty in working without the caste data and recommended that caste data be collected in the next census
